PBM Reporting Transparency Act

Summary
PBM Reporting Transparency Act This bill requires the Medicare Payment Advisory Commission to report certain information about pharmacy benefit managers (PBMs) under the Medicare prescription drug benefit and Medicare Advantage. Specifically, the commission must report on trends in agreements between PBMs and prescription drug plans, the impact of any differences in agreements on out-of-pocket spending for enrollees and pharmacy reimbursements, and any appropriate recommendations. The commission must submit an updated report two years after its initial report.
